As modern parents, we often find ourselves stressed about purchasing the latest expensive toys, like elaborate play kitchens. We scour reviews and seek advice on social media, forgetting that our children find immense joy in the simplest of materials—like cardboard boxes. It’s perplexing to consider why we would spend hundreds of dollars on toys when we could easily construct similar items for next to nothing.
Take, for instance, the inspiring story of a mother named Sarah Thompson, who aimed to delight her 2-year-old son, Liam, with a new toy. Instead of buying an expensive play kitchen, she crafted a remarkable cardboard kitchen that has captured the hearts of many. Sarah and her partner gathered various boxes, meticulously marked areas to cut out for the oven and cabinets, and adorned their creation with colorful decals to spark Liam’s imagination. They even added a charming sign reading “Liam’s Café,” showcasing their creativity.
Sarah is not alone in her innovative approach. The internet, particularly platforms like Pinterest, is brimming with DIY cardboard toy ideas suitable for parents with varying skill levels.
Though it’s true that cardboard creations can succumb to the whims of a toddler’s exuberance, that’s part of the allure. Once a child loses interest, you can easily recycle the cardboard without the guilt of discarding a costly toy. This flexibility allows you to focus on creating something new and exciting without the burden of significant financial investment.
While some parents may enjoy the challenge of designing intricate cardboard structures, it’s essential to recognize that children will be thrilled with even the simplest of boxes. Whether you choose to embellish your creation or keep it minimalistic, the goal is to provide a playful outlet for your child without breaking the bank. After all, it’s far less stressful to say goodbye to a cardboard toy compared to a pricey plaything that might sit unused in your home.
